Paul Marquis (born 29 August 1972) is an English former football defender.

Quick Facts Personal information, Full name ...

Marquis came through the schoolboy sides of Cheshunt and made 15 appearances for their first team as an eighteen-year-old before moving to the youth squad for West Ham United. Graduating through the reserve team, Marquis played only 60 seconds of first-team football for West Ham, coming on in the 90th minute for Mike Marsh, in February 1994, in a 0–0 draw with Manchester City.[1] In March 1994 Marquis was given a free transfer by West Ham and was signed by Doncaster Rovers.[2]
